7

CHAPTER 

VERSE

16

चतुर्विधा भजन्ते मां जना: सुकृतिनोऽर्जुन |
आर्तो जिज्ञासुरर्थार्थी ज्ञानी च भरतर्षभ || 7.16 ||

chaturvidhā bhajante māṁ janāḥ sukṛitino'rjuna
ārto jijñāsurarthārthī jñānī cha bharatarṣhabha ||

Four kinds of pious people worship Me, O Arjun—the distressed, the seeker of knowledge, the seeker of wealth, and the wise.

Lesson:

In this world, there are various types of individuals who worship Shri Krishna. These are categorized into four main groups based on their motivations and aspirations. Firstly, there are those who are in distress, facing challenges and difficulties in life. Seeking solace and relief, they turn to the divine for support and guidance. Secondly, there are the seekers of knowledge, individuals who are curious and eager to understand the deeper truths of existence. They approach God with a thirst for spiritual wisdom and enlightenment.

The third category comprises those who seek material wealth and prosperity. Driven by desires for worldly success and abundance, they also recognize the importance of divine blessings in achieving their goals. Finally, there are the wise, individuals who have attained a deeper understanding of life and its mysteries. They worship the divine not out of necessity or desire but out of reverence and gratitude for the universal truths they have realized.

Through this classification, Lord Krishna highlights that irrespective of their motivations, all sincere worshippers are worthy of His grace and guidance.
